The Lead Registered Nurse (RN) provides high-quality clinical support to physicians and advanced practice providers (APPs), helping meet the operational needs of the practice and the healthcare needs of patients. Working collaboratively with physicians, interdisciplinary teams, patients, and families, the Lead RN promotes safe, efficient, and patient-centered care. This role is responsible for assessing and evaluating patient conditions, developing and implementing individualized plans of care, delivering and documenting nursing care, and ensuring practice aligns with professional nursing standards, organizational policies, and evidence-based practices. This is a unique opportunity to support two growing specialty practices—Gastroenterology and Endocrinology—at the Highlands Ranch location. The Lead RN will have the opportunity to collaborate with multidisciplinary teams across both clinics, helping shape workflows, improve patient care processes, and contribute to the continued growth and success of these expanding programs. In addition to direct patient care responsibilities, the Lead RN serves as a clinical leader, mentor, and subject matter expert for the department. This individual partners with the Practice Manager and/or Director to support staff onboarding, training, competency development, daily workflow coordination, and clinical operations. The Lead RN also champions process improvement initiatives, assists with departmental development, promotes quality and patient safety, and helps foster a culture of teamwork, accountability, and continuous learning while serving as a resource for clinical and operational questions.
